Then on Thursday we got a phone call from the zone leaders that we were having interviews with President and that we needed to change our schedule for the day to be there. So i guess the First Presidency sent a new program they wanted implemented into the missions, making things not as focused by transfers but by months.. so now interviews and zone conference will only be every quarter.. So at least I got my interview for this transfer but I will not get another zone conference in my mission so that's sad. And then they changed it where they will have three day long leadership trainings every month and instead of transfer focuses they will be monthly focuses.. and President will do a specialized training monthly however he feels he wants to... to a zone, to a district or even to a companionship.
